Methodology
Transparent calculation
BuildMeter converts every input to a consistent internal unit, applies the selected allowance, and rounds products up to whole purchasable units.
Billing energy = daily kWh × billing days. Bill = energy charge + fixed charge + other charges + tax or surcharge.
FAQ
Electricity Bill Calculator questions
What rate should I enter for tiered pricing?+
Use the blended energy charge divided by billed kWh from a representative bill.
Does this include solar credits?+
Only when you reduce the entered daily grid use or enter a negative credit outside this simple calculator.
Why can the utility total differ?+
Utilities may apply time-of-use rates, demand charges, fuel adjustments, taxes and credits separately.
